Through angioplasty, our cardiologists are able to treat patients with blocked or clogged coronary arteries quickly without surgery.During the procedure, a cardiologist threads a balloon-tipped catheter to the site of the narrowed or blocked artery and then inflates the balloon to open the vessel.
